What is a YouTube Link?

A YouTube link is essentially the URL (Uniform Resource Locator) that leads to a specific YouTube video. This link can be shared via email, social media platforms, embedded into websites, or simply copied and pasted into a browser. YouTube links are unique to each video, making it easy to share and access specific content.

Structure of a YouTube Link:

A standard YouTube link can vary in structure but typically follows a pattern like this:

https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=VIDEO_ID

  • https://www.youtube.com: This is the base URL for YouTube.
  • watch?v=: This parameter indicates that what follows is a video ID.
  • VIDEO_ID: This is a unique identifier for each video on YouTube, usually consisting of a combination of letters and numbers.

Types of YouTube Links:

  1. Watch Page Link: This is the most common type of link, leading directly to a video on the YouTube watch page.

  2. Embed Link: These links allow you to embed a video directly into a webpage or blog post. The structure is slightly different:

    https://www.youtube.com/embed/VIDEO_ID

    Embedding videos can enhance user experience on your site, providing direct access to video content without users having to leave the page.

  3. Shortened YouTube Links: YouTube and third-party services offer link shortening. A shortened link is easier to remember and share:

    youtu.be/VIDEO_ID

    These links redirect to the full YouTube video page.

The Video ID: The string of letters and numbers after v= is the unique identifier for that specific video. What Does "xn" Mean in Web Addresses?

If you see web links starting with xn--, you are looking at Punycode.

International Domains: Punycode is used to translate non-Latin characters (like Chinese, Cyrillic, or Arabic alphabets) into an ASCII-compatible encoding.

How it works: It allows systems that only understand basic English characters to read and direct users to websites with native-language web addresses.

Security Note: Always be careful clicking on strange-looking xn-- links, as bad actors sometimes use them to disguise phishing websites as legitimate platforms. 🔗 The Art of URL Shortening

To get a text version (transcript) of what is being said in a YouTube video:

Built-in Transcript: In the video description, click More and scroll to the bottom to find the Show Transcript button. This displays a time-stamped text box next to the video.

Third-Party Tools: Websites like Vizard.ai allow you to paste a YouTube URL to automatically generate a full text transcription for editing or repurposing. 3. Adding Text Overlays to a YouTube Video
